Best Race for a Crusader
As previously mentioned, striking a balance between proper attacking aspects and magical aspects is necessary in building a perfect Crusader. Hence, races like
Nord
,
Breto
n
or
Imperial
will be your perfect choice.
Best Birthsign for a Crusader
As a Crusader is a combat-focused class, opting for
The Lord
birthsign would be a wise choice for you. Not only it boosts the Strength attribute, but also heals yourself fully once a day. Along with it, it increases the Restoration spell as well.
Best Attributes for a Crusader
Strength:
This has to be your go-to attribute if you want to master Crusader as this increases the damage dealt by melee attacks with swords, maces or even bare hands. Not only that, this attribute makes you strong enough to wear heavy armor without being slowed down.
Willpower:
Along with Strength, you will need Willpower to harness the power of magic. That means, with this attribute, you will be able to cast powerful spells. This attribute will also help you in defense as it will block opponent spells as well.
Best Skills for a Crusader
Blade:
This skill allows you effective and faster melee attacks with a sword.
Blunt:
If you want some heavy blow, instead of Blade, you can look into this. With this skill, you will be able to deal crushing attacks with maces and hammers. It also blocks opposing attacks as this skill is all about raw force.
Heavy Armor:
A Crusader is the Tank of the team, so he ought to have Heavy Armors in the battlefield. And you already have the Strength attribute, you are not going to slow down that much wearing those.
Restoration:
As a Tank, you are certain to face the heavier share of incoming damages from your opponents. So, make sure to add this skill into your inventory, as it will not only heal yourself but your teammates as well. Even higher Restoration skills unlock higher level healing spells.
Best Spells for a Crusader
Restore Fatigue:
Crusaders are made for long-standing duels, and for that you need to keep your stamina up to the mark. This spell will do that for you.
Fireball:
This spell is a great way for you to start the battle. As it's very cost-effective and huge damage dealing, this is a reliable option.
Shield:
As previously mentioned, you are going to get the maximum amount of attacks from the enemies. That is why you need this spell to add a temporary armor rating, to save your actual armor.
Weakness to Fire:
This spell boosts damages dealt by weapon enchantment and elemental strikes.

Japan's Megaquake: Why the next big tremor could be catastrophic
Japan is intensifying its earthquake preparedness following a sudden spike in seismic activity in the Tokara Islands, where over 900 tremors have been recorded in the past eleven days. The Japan Meteorological Agency confirmed a magnitude 5.5 earthquake on Wednesday. Though it caused no major damage, the sheer frequency of tremors has heightened public anxiety and renewed fears of a larger disaster. At the center of national concern is the Nankai Trough, an 800-kilometer fault off Japan's southeastern coast where two tectonic plates converge. Historically, this region produces massive earthquakes every 100 to 200 years. The last major rupture occurred in 1946. According to government experts, there is now a 75 to 82 percent chance that a magnitude 8 or higher earthquake will strike this area within the next 30 years. Such an event would likely trigger a tsunami and cause widespread destruction. New damage projections reveal scale of risk In March, the Japanese government released updated projections based on current topographical and structural data. Despite the updated numbers being somewhat lower, the scale of risk remains among the highest ever recorded for a potential natural disaster. Original safety goals not met Following the 2011 Tōhoku earthquake and tsunami, which caused around 18,000 deaths and led to the Fukushima nuclear disaster, Japan introduced a national disaster prevention plan focused on the Nankai threat. That plan, created in 2014, aimed to reduce potential deaths by 80 percent and cut building destruction by 50 percent within ten years. Those targets were not met by the 2024 deadline. Nevertheless, government officials say they are keeping the same targets in place, calling them aspirational goals that reflect the seriousness of the threat. In response to both the updated damage estimates and the recent surge in tremors, the central government is accelerating key measures. These include expanding emergency evacuation shelters and reinforcing coastal sea walls in areas likely to be hit by tsunamis. During a recent cabinet meeting, Prime Minister Fumio Kishida emphasized the need for coordination between government agencies, local authorities, private companies, and non-profit organizations to ensure maximum protection of life and property. Public anxiety fuelled by culture and speculation Social media discussions and references in popular culture have added to the rising sense of concern. A well-known manga has gained attention for predicting a major disaster on July 5, 2025. While the storyline is fictional and not backed by scientific evidence, the date has gone viral and is contributing to the current mood of unease, particularly in areas like the Tokara Islands that continue to experience repeated tremors. Japan experiences around 1,500 earthquakes every year, but the threat posed by the Nankai Trough is serious due to its potential for destruction. Thus the authorities in Japan are taking the threat seriously and increasing their level of disaster preparedness.

Birds that depend on clean waterbodies and wetlands are at risk: PAU expert
Ludhiana: As International Plastic Bag Free Day is observed on July 3, rising use of plastics, including plastic bags, are posing an unprecedented threat to bird population. Ornithologists and conservationists are sounding urgent alarms about the growing menace of plastic pollution — that is choking habitats, contaminating food chains, and pushing several bird species to the brink of collapse. Plastic has turned into a long-lasting hazard in natural ecosystems. Each year, over 400 million tonnes of plastic are produced globally, and a staggering amount finds its way into the open environment. In India, this translates into clogged village ponds, polluted rivers, and shrinking wetlands, all vital habitats for birdlife. "Plastic pollution is now a leading factor contributing to bird population decline across India," Dr Tejdeep Kaur Kler, principal ornithologist and head of the zoology department at Punjab Agricultural University (PAU), Ludhiana. "Carnivorous and insectivorous birds that depend on clean water bodies and wetlands are especially at risk." Village ponds, traditionally key sources of drinking water and biodiversity, in most villages have become open dumping grounds for domestic waste, especially plastic wrappers, single-use bags, and packaging material. Plastic impacts birds in multiple deadly ways. Many mistake colorful plastic fragments for food bottle caps resemble eggs or snails, shredded bags look like worms or jellyfish. Ingested plastics fill the gut and block the digestive system, causing starvation and death. Parents also feed these items to their chicks unknowingly, mistaking them for prey. Recent field reports from Tamil Nadu, Uttar Pradesh, and Assam reveal deaths of kingfishers, herons, and egrets with plastics inside their stomachs, she stated. Species such as vultures, eagles, and the Ruddy Shelduck, crans, and many more species of birds that rely heavily on clean aquatic habitats and a balanced food chain are facing alarming declines. "Hundreds of species are witnessing population drops. The Ruddy Shelduck has declined sharply. So have scavenging raptors and fish-eating birds," notes Dr Kler, citing a 2023 national study which identified 178 of 942 recorded bird species in India as needing immediate conservation attention. Another 323 species were classified under moderate conservation concern. The plastic threat extends beyond ingestion. Birds often become entangled in plastic ropes, packaging bands, and kite strings, leading to injuries, restricted movement, and death. Urban species such as kites and pigeons are increasingly seen with deformed limbs or wings due to plastic threads, especially during kite flying festivals. 'Bird nests no longer safe' Even bird nests are no longer safe. Many urban birds now incorporate synthetic fibers and plastic strips into their nests, which leach toxins, retain excess heat, and entangle chicks before they can fledge. Insects, fish, and other prey consumed by birds are themselves contaminated with microplastics tiny fragments that carry hazardous chemicals like DDT and PCBs, known to disrupt hormones and immunity. A 2022 study by the Indian Institute of Science even detected microplastics in crow feces in Bengaluru, indicating how deep and invisible the plastic infiltration runs, she said. Wetlands and marshes, which host a wide range of migratory and resident birds, are particularly vulnerable. Plastic clogs aquatic vegetation, reduces fish nurseries, and alters the food web. In places like Chilika Lake in Odisha and East Kolkata Wetlands, scientists have linked falling bird counts to plastic contamination in water bodies, she stated. 'Weak enforcement of plastic ban' Despite bans on single-use plastics at the national level in 2022 and earlier initiatives like Punjab's 2016 prohibition on plastic bags, enforcement remains weak. Informal dumping continues unabated, and waste collection and segregation mechanisms are often inadequate or non-functional in rural and peri-urban areas. "Birds are indicators of environmental health. When they disappear, it is not just their loss it is a warning to humanity. If plastic continues to poison our rivers, ponds, and skies, the silence of the birds will soon echo our own ecological failure," she stated.
